Requirements

Deep domain knowledge of compute infrastructure components: servers, GPUs/TPUs, networking equipment, storage, racks, power distribution, and cooling infrastructure

Experience managing capital-intensive procurement portfolios (multi $B+) including negotiation, category strategy, and vendor consolidation

Strong understanding of procure-to-pay processes, purchase order governance, and asset lifecycle management

Experience operating in SOX-compliant environments with understanding of ITGCs, ICFR, and financial control frameworks

Experience with international procurement operations including entity structuring, customs/export controls, VAT/GST recovery, and cross-border logistics

Proven track record of process improvement, systems implementation, and workflow automation in high-growth environments

Responsibilities

Supplier Strategy & Cost Optimization

Own key supplier relationships across compute hardware (networking, storage, racks, power infrastructure) and negotiate pricing frameworks, and volume commitments

Establish playbooks and sourcing strategies for hyperscale infrastructure procurement

Drive material savings through partnering with strategic sourcing teams within the Data Center Design and Ops teams, vendor consolidation, and commercial optimization across a multi-billion dollar spend portfolio

Support contract negotiations and understand the liabilities and obligations with compute vendors

Anthropic is seeking a Director of Infrastructure Compute Procurement to build and lead the function responsible for how Anthropic procures, tracks, and governs its compute infrastructure assets at scale. This is a function-building role within the Finance org.

You will own supplier strategy, cost optimization, and category management for one of the largest and most complex capital procurement portfolios in AI. You will simultaneously operationalize three enterprise-scale initiatives: a multi-entity procurement structure spanning domestic and international jurisdictions, a compliance-critical Asset Lifecycle Management program and procurement operations for Anthropic data center sites across the US with international expansion underway.

This role reports directly to the Head of Procurement and serves as the senior procurement leader embedded with Infrastructure Accounting, Finance, Tax, Legal, and DC Operations. You are building the team, the playbooks, and the systems that will govern billions of dollars in compute infrastructure spend.
